I've eaten hash browns before with no problem, but I had a reaction to a different brand today. The ingredients were listed as - potato, veg oil, salt, dextrose, potato starch, emulsifier: hydroxypropyl methylcellulose; spice.

Wonder what it is I'm reacting to ???

No not different types of coeliac, but different levels of sensitivity and we use different products.

Vegetable oil can be made from lots of different plants, seeds, etc. Wheat being one of them. Vegetable oil can also include maize, palm oil, linseed, rapeseed, sunflowers.....

Many supermarket veg oils are now derived from rapeseed.

Problem is you don't know what manufacturers use and whether it is wheat based. I know from practical experience I have had issues with some foods whose ingredients are gluten free and yet contain vegetable oil.

As a consequence I tend to avoid any unless it specifically says the source, e.g. Sunflower or rapeseed.
